WebTucked away in the valley of the Maquoketa River lies Iowa's oldest state park, Backbone State Park, where the scenery is rugged and awe-inspiring. The rustic architecture of the park dates back to the time it was first established in 1920, and its charm has only been heightened through the years. With 21 miles of beautiful hiking trails, a ... WebMay 14, 2024 · The Maquoketa River is best known for smallmouth bass and float trips. However, in its upper reaches, it is a clear and beautiful trout stream.
